> The way the FreeBSD port manages this sort of configuraton is to patch
> the src/EDITME file to provide some XX_FOO_XX hooks which can then be
> adjusted afterwards.  Look at files/patch-src::EDITME.
> 
> Honestly, your easiest approach is going to be:
>   make patch
>   vi work/exim-*/src/EDITME
>   make
